Buckhannon-Upshur Middle School students become newest Knights of the Golden Horseshoe

Buckhannon, WV – A long-standing tradition in West Virginia education continued this week as four 8th-grade students from Buckhannon-Upshur Middle School were named the newest Knights of the Golden Horseshoe. The school would like to extend its congratulations to Johnny Chen, Landon Beaudry, Xavier Robinette, and Zethyn Wiseman for their achievements.

The Golden Horseshoe test, administered annually since 1931, is a comprehensive exam designed to assess the knowledge of West Virginia’s 8th-grade students on the state’s history, geography, and culture. The test is a rite of passage for many students, marking a significant milestone in their educational journey.

Each year, top-scoring students from every county are awarded the prestigious Golden Horseshoe and are inducted as “Knights” of the order. This honor not only recognizes their academic excellence but also highlights their dedication and passion for learning about the state they call home.
